Tsvangirai returns to Zimbabwe after crash
Zimbabwe’s prime minister was heading home to resume his duties today after receiving medical treatment in Botswana.
Morgan Tsvangirai was injured in a car crash last week in which his wife, Susan, was killed.
A spokesman said Mr Tsvangirai was returning to Harare today because that is what his wife would have wanted.
He arrived in Botswana on Saturday, a day after the crash.
He also spent months there last year, fearing for his life at the height of a stand-off with President Robert Mugabe – the man with whom he formed a joint government last month.
Thousands of Zimbabweans have visited Mr Tsvangirai’s Harare home to offer their condolences.
Plans were underway for a rally in his wife’s honour tomorrow and her funeral on Wednesday.
